SALAD WITH GOAT CHEESE, PEARS, CANDIED PECANS AND MAPLE-BALSAMIC DRESSING



Salad with Goat Cheese, Pears, Candied Pecans and Maple-Balsamic Dressing image

An incredibly delicious, yet really easy salad recipe! An absolutely perfect Thanksgiving salad, or holiday salad for dinner parties ... but quick enough for family dinners, too! • Ready in 30 Minutes or Less • Includes Make-Ahead Steps • Vegetarian •

Provided by Two Healthy Kitchens LLC at www.TwoHealthyKitchens.com

Categories     Salads

Time 10m

Number Of Ingredients 10

5 ounces of mixed gourmet/spring greens
1 pear (such as d'Anjou), cored and chopped (to equal about 1 1/4 cups) (see note)
1 cup glazed, candied pecans (see note)
2/3 cup dried cherries (or cherry-flavored Craisins)
4 ounces crumbled goat cheese
2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
1 1/2 tablespoons pure maple syrup
1 tablespoon olive oil
1/2 teaspoon smooth dijon mustard
a pinch (about 1/16 teaspoon) kosher salt

Steps:

  • Place greens in a large serving bowl (or divide among individual salad plates).
  • Sprinkle pears, pecans, cherries, and goat cheese over top of greens.
  • For dressing, whisk together balsamic vinegar, maple syrup, olive oil, mustard, and salt until emulsified.
  • Dress salad just before serving, or pass the dressing at the table.

GOAT CHEESE SALAD WITH PANCETTA, DRIED CHERRY AND PORT DRESSING



Goat Cheese Salad with Pancetta, Dried Cherry and Port Dressing image

Categories     Salad     Nut     Pork     Side     Bake     Sauté     Goat Cheese     Cherry     Pine Nut     Spinach     Port     Fall     Bon Appétit

Yield Makes 4 Serv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 1/4 cups dried tart cherries
1/2 cup tawny Port
5 ounces pancetta or bacon, chopped
2 shallots, minced
1 garlic clove, minced
1/3 cup olive oil
1/4 cup red wine vinegar
2 teaspoons sugar
1 5.5-ounce log soft fresh goat cheese (such as Montrachet), cut into 1/2-inch-thick slices
1 5-ounce bag mixed salad greens
1/2 cup pine nuts, toasted

Steps:

  • Combine cherries and Port in heavy small saucepan. Bring to simmer over medium heat. Remove from heat; let stand until cherries swell, about 15 minutes. Sauté pancetta in heavy large skillet over medium-low heat until crisp, about 8 minutes. Add shallots and garlic; cook 2 minutes. Add oil, then vinegar and sugar; stir until sugar dissolves. Stir in cherry mixture. Season with salt and pepper. (Dressing can be made 2 hours ahead. Set aside in skillet at room temperature.)
  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Place goat cheese slices on rimmed baking sheet. Bake until warm, about 10 minutes. Meanwhile, combine salad greens and pine nuts in bowl. Rewarm dressing and pour over salad; toss to blend. Top with warm goat cheese and serve.

GREEK SALAD WITH GOAT CHEESE



Greek Salad With Goat Cheese image

This recipe, brought to The Times in a 1991 article about the increasing popularity of goat cheese, is simple and full of bright flavors and satisfying textures. Feta, the cheese traditionally used in this classic salad, would be perfectly appropriate (and delicious), but we recommend giving goat cheese a try. The silken texture of the goat cheese contrasts beautifully with the lively crunch of the vegetables.

Provided by Florence Fabricant

Categories     salads and dressings

Time 25m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 17

Kosher salt
1 garlic clove, halved
4 cups romaine lettuce, rinsed, dried and torn into small pieces
8 medium-sized radishes, sliced
1 small red onion, sliced paper-thin and separated into rings
6 scallions, trimmed and chopped
1 small green pepper, cored, seeded and sliced into thin strips
1 pint ripe cherry tomatoes, hulled and halved
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 tablespoon finely chopped fresh mint
1 tablespoon finely chopped fresh dill
1/2 cup fruity extra-virgin olive oil
3 tablespoons red wine vinegar
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
6 ounces dried textured plain goat cheese, crumbled
8 Greek or Italian black olives in oil, drained
4 to 8 anchovy fillets drained

Steps:

  • Sprinkle a little kosher salt into a large glass or ceramic salad bowl. Rub the cut side of the garlic over the salt. Discard the garlic.
  • Place the lettuce, radishes, onion, scallions, green pepper and tomatoes in the bowl. Add the oregano, mint and dill.
  • Shortly before serving add the olive oil, toss, then add the vinegar. Season the salad to taste with salt and pepper.
  • Crumble the goat cheese over the salad, then arrange the olives and anchovy fillets on top. Toss again at the table before serving.

BEET AND GOAT CHEESE ARUGULA SALAD



Beet and Goat Cheese Arugula Salad image

Provided by Giada De Laurentiis

Categories     appetizer

Time 42m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
3 tablespoons shallots, thinly sliced
1 tablespoon honey
1/3 cup extra-virgin olive oil
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
6 medium beets, cooked and quartered
6 cups fresh arugula
1/2 cup walnuts, toasted, coarsely chopped
1/4 cup dried cranberries or dried cherries
1/2 avocado, peeled, pitted, and cubed
3 ounces soft fresh goat cheese, coarsely crumbled

Steps:

  • Line a baking sheet with foil.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F.
  • Whisk the vinegar, shallots, and honey in a medium bowl to blend. Gradually whisk in the oil. Season the vinaigrette, to taste, with salt and pepper. Toss the beets in a small bowl with enough dressing to coat. Place the beets on the prepared baking sheet and roast until the beets are slightly caramelized, stirring occasionally, about 12 minutes. Set aside and cool.
  • Toss the arugula, walnuts, and cranberries in a large bowl with enough vinaigrette to coat. Season the salad, to taste, with salt and pepper. Mound the salad atop 4 plates. Arrange the beets around the salad. Sprinkle with the avocado and goat cheese, and serve.

SPRING SALAD WITH CREAMY GOAT CHEESE DRESSING



Spring Salad with Creamy Goat Cheese Dressing image

Provided by Brian Boitano

Categories     appetizer

Time 45m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 24

1/2 teaspoon paprika
1/4 teaspoon ground coriander
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/4 cup sugar
1 tablespoon butter
1 cup pecans
Nonstick cooking spray
4 ounces goat cheese, at room temperature
2 tablespoons buttermilk
1 teaspoon honey
1 teaspoon white wine vinegar
2 tablespoons olive oil
1/4 teaspoon white pepper
Pinch salt
1 tablespoon chopped fresh tarragon leaves
1/2 cup canola oil
2 shallots, thinly sliced
8 cups spring greens mix
Goat Cheese Dressing
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Chopped candied pecans
1 1/2 cups red grapes, sliced in 1/2

Steps:

  • Spiced Pecans:
  • In a small bowl combine the paprika, ground coriander, cayenne pepper, salt, and pepper. Set aside.
  • In a small saucepan over medium heat add the sugar and cook until all of the sugar is melted and light brown in color. Carefully whisk in the butter. Add the spice mix and turn off the heat. Add the pecans and stir with a rubber spatula until all of the pecans are completely coated. Spray with nonstick cooking spray which will help the pecans separate. Once all of the pecans are coated turn out onto a greased sheet tray or a sheet tray lined with a silicone mat. Break up any pieces that may be stuck together. Let cool 5 minutes before serving with the salad.
  • In a medium bowl whisk together the goat cheese and buttermilk. Whisk in the remaining dressing ingredients until combined and smooth. Set aside.
  • Heat the canola oil in a small saucepan over medium heat. Add the shallots and fry until crispy and light brown, about 5 minutes. Remove to a plate lined with a paper towel to drain.
  • Add the greens to a large bowl. Drizzle with 3/4 of the dressing, season with salt and pepper, to taste, and toss to coat the greens. Transfer the salad to a platter and garnish with candied pecans, sliced grapes, and fried shallots. Drizzle with remaining dressing and serve.

WARM GOAT CHEESE AND SUN-DRIED TOMATO SALAD



Warm Goat Cheese and Sun-Dried Tomato Salad image

This salad is hea-ven-ly! I make a few salads with goat cheese (what a yummy treat!), but this one, in which the goat cheese is warmed, is scrumptious beyond words. Very impressive, too! The vinagrette dressing is is a great one to use on other salads, as well. This comes from Linda McCartney's vegetarian cookbook and I often serve it with a grourmet soup and warm bread for a lovely, complete meal.

Provided by Helping Hands

Categories     Free Of...

Time 20m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 (7 1/2 ounce) bag mixed greens (preferably with radicchio leaves)
1 7/8 ounces spinach leaves
1 bunch watercress
2 tablespoons finely chopped onions
4 sun-dried tomatoes, sliced (packed in oil)
olive oil
6 ounces creamy goat cheese
5 tablespoons olive oil
1/2 teaspoon yellow mustard
2 tablespoons lemon juice
2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
1 -2 clove minced garlic
salt and pepper

Steps:

  • Dressing:.
  • Mix together mustard, lemon juice, and vinegar.
  • Salt and pepper to taste.
  • Whisk in olive oil slowly, allowing dressing to thicken.
  • Add garlic and mix well.
  • Let stand for 30 minutes.
  • Salad:.
  • Pre-heat broiler.
  • Mix all greens and salad leaves in salad bowl.
  • Add onion, sun-dried tomatoes, and dressing, and toss well.
  • Place on individual plates.
  • Brush goat cheese with olive oil and place under broiler (on sprayed cookie sheet) for a few minutes, until cheese bubbles and turns slightly golden in color.
  • Place goat cheese slices on top of individual salads, and serve while warm.

WARM GOAT CHEESE SALAD WITH DRIED CHERRIES AND PANCETTA VINAIGRETTE



Warm Goat Cheese Salad with Dried Cherries and Pancetta Vinaigrette image

Categories     Salad     Sauté     Goat Cheese     Cherry     Lettuce     Gourmet

Yield Serves 4 generously

Number Of Ingredients 9

8 cups mesclun (mixed baby greens), washed and dried
4 ounces dried cherries (about 1 cup)
6 ounces soft mild goat cheese
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per, or to taste
a 1/2-pound piece of pancetta (Italian unsmoked cured bacon), cut into strips about 1/8-inch thick and 1 inch long
1/4 cup olive oil
1 tablespoon finely chopped garlic
1 tablespoon finely chopped fresh thyme leaves
6 tablespoons sherry vinegar

Steps:

  • In a large serving bowl, combine mesclun and dried cherries. Crumble goat cheese on top and sprinkle with pepper.
  • In a large skillet cook pancetta in oil over moderate heat, stirring, until lightly browned. Pour off about 3 tablespoons (about 1/3 cup should be left in skillet with pancetta). Add garlic and sauté mixture, stirring, until garlic is golden. Carefully add thyme and vinegar. Increase heat to moderately high and boil mixture 1 minute.
  • Add hot vinaigrette to salad and toss. Serve salad immediately.

BALSAMIC GOAT CHEESE SALAD DRESSING



Balsamic Goat Cheese Salad Dressing image

I came up with this while on a 30-Day Detox. I needed to be creative with foods that I was allowed (and not allowed), and this is what I've come up with. Amounts are approximate, I eyeballed everything.

Provided by Sandra E.

Categories     Salad Dressings

Time 5m

Yield 1/2 cup of dressing, 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1/2 cup olive oil
1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
1 large garlic clove
1 1/2 ounces plain goat cheese
1/2 teaspoon fresh ground pepper
1 teaspoon dried basil

Steps:

  • Throw everything in the blender/food processor/hand-held immersion blender(mine has an attachment with a cup and lid, so I don't even need another container).
  • Blend until everything is combined.
  • Use right away or store in a jar in the fridge. You may need to give it a good shake just before using if you let it sit in the fridge for a few days.

GOAT CHEESE SALAD WITH PANCETTA, GARLIC AND FIGS



Goat Cheese Salad With Pancetta, Garlic and Figs image

Provided by Molly O'Neill

Categories     easy, quick, salads and dressings

Time 15m

Yield Four serv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

1/2 pound pancetta, cut into small dice
4 tablespoons olive oil
4 teaspoons minced garlic
2 teaspoons minced fresh thyme
3/4 cup sherry vinegar
1/2 pound goat cheese
8 cups mixed wild greens, washed and stemmed
12 fresh or dried figs, stemmed and halved
Salt and freshly ground p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Place the pancetta in a large skillet over low heat and cook until it has browned and released half of its fat. Remove the pancetta from the skillet with a slotted spoon. Add the olive oil to the skillet and increase the heat to medium. When the pancetta is hot but not smoking, return it to the pan and cook for a few seconds.
  • Add the garlic and cook until lightly browned. Add the thyme and cook just until it makes a popping sound. Stir in the vinegar and simmer until reduced to 1/4 cup, about 5 minutes. Crumble the goat cheese into the skillet and cook just until it begins to weep. Toss in the greens and immediately remove the pan from the heat. Toss in the figs and season with salt and pepper to taste. Place the salad in a bowl and serve warm.
